* WHAT...Small stream flooding caused by excessive rainfall is expected.
* WHERE...South Central Pima County in southeastern Arizona, mainly along Highway 286 between Three Points and Arivaca Road...
* WHEN...Until 500 PM MST.
*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as. Rises in small streams and normally dry washes.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 302 PM MST, Doppler radar indicated heavy rain due to thunderstorms. This will cause small stream flooding. Between 0.75 and 1.75 inches of rain have fallen. - Additional rainfall amounts up to 0.5 inches are expected over the area. This additional rain will result in minor flooding. - Some locations that will experience flooding include...
